TRDP Supports Opening of Family Business in Shatin, Vayots Dzor

SHATIN, Armenia ‒ In July, 2018, the opening ceremony of a newly-built retail store took place in the village of Shatin, Vayots Dzor region of Armenia. The shop belongs to entrepreneur Igor Sargsyan, who managed to open his family business in his own community with the support and guidance of the Turpanjian Rural Development Program (TRDP) of the American University of Armenia (AUA).

The opening ceremony was attended by many guests, including people from Shatin and surrounding communities, as well as the chair of AUA TRDP, Dr. Haroutune Armenian, and other staff.

Sargsyan applied to the program in 2017, participated in business trainings organized by the program, received the funding, and finally launched his business in May 2018.

The retail store is a fully-fledged and well-prepared premise which is also equipped with a refrigerator and an air-conditioner to keep the shop attractive and convenient for its customers. Beautiful and well-designed shelves for goods adorn the walls of the shop interior.

During the opening ceremony, Sargsyan greatly emphasized the role, contributions and guidance of TRDP and its team from the very start of the project to its completion.

 

The AUA Turpanjian Rural Development Program provides education, funding and consultations to the existing and startup businesses in rural areas of Shirak, Tavush, Vayots Dzor regions of Armenia, in Artsakh, and Javakhk (Georgia). The program continues accepting applications.
